Hướng dẫn tạo web service với PHP

Web service là gì? Web service là một dịch vụ web được sử dụng để trao đổi thông tin giữa các hệ thống phần mềm. Lấy ví dụ bạn xây dựng phần mềm cho phép khách du lịch đặt phòng ở khách sạn. Trong trường hợp này, bạn muốn hệ thống của mình lấy thông tin khách du lịch từ các công ty lữ hành. Trong tình huống này, chúng ta sẽ sử dụng web service. Bài viết hướng dẫn tạo web service với PHP là một trong nhiều cách để thực hiện điều đó.

Như chúng ta đã biết, ngoài PHP bạn có thể sử dụng ngôn ngữ lập trình khác như Java hoặc C#, …Trong bài này, tác giả sử dụng PHP kết hợp với MySQL để tạo ra web service trả về định dạng JSON.

Hướng dẫn tạo web service với PHP – Chuẩn bị

Web server bao gồm Apache và MySQL. Chúng tôi sử dụng MAMP trên môi trường Mac. Các bạn có thể sử dụng XAMP trên môi trường Windows. Các bạn xem hướng dẫn cài đặt và sử dụng MAMP trên Mac để biết cách cài đặt và sử dụng MAMP

Hướng dẫn tạo web service với PHP – Các bước thực hiện

1/ Tạo cơ sở dữ liệu tên pfdb

Truy cập phpMyAdmin -> chọn SQL (1) -> nhâp câu lệnh  tạo cơ sở dữ liệu (2) -> chọn Go (3)

Cơ sở dữ liệu sau khi tạo

2/ Tạo bảng pftbl gồm 1 cột là name

Bảng sau khi tạo

3/ Thêm dữ liệu vào bảng pftbl

Dữ liệu sau khi thêm

4/ Viết code PHP

4.1/ Tạo thư mục pf trong thư mục htdocs

4.2/ Tạo tập tin display.php trong thư mục pf

Code tập tin display.php

5/ Chạy web service

5.1/ Link truy cập

5.2/ Kết quả

Chúc các bạn thành công!
BQT – http://giasutinhoc.vn